How to Remove Mineral Deposits from Granite Countertops ...

White mineral deposits on granite countertops are a typical result of hard water. If the countertop has been properly maintained and resealed on schedule (typically every 612 months) the mineral deposits will be topical and relatively easy to remove. If the countertop seal has been compromised, you may need to call in a professional.
Moh's Scale of Hardness Marblecare Ltd.Moh's Scale of Hardness Marblecare Ltd.

Moh's Scale of Hardness Marblecare Ltd.

The universal scale used to test the hardness of a mineral or rock is known as Moh's scale. It was devised by the Austrian mineralogist Frederick Moh in the early 1800's as a crude but practical method of comparing scratch resistance.

Orthoclase: Pink granite, Mohs hardness and moonstoneOrthoclase: Pink granite, Mohs hardness and moonstone

Orthoclase: Pink granite, Mohs hardness and moonstone

Orthoclase Gemology. As a mineral with a Mohs hardness of 6 and two directions of perfect cleavage, orthoclase is not an especially durable gemstone. It will develop abrasions if used in most types of jewelry, and it can easily cleave upon impact.
